Banks in Akure shut over robbery scare






Banks in the Akure metropolis on Thursday hurriedly closed their doors to customers after news spread that armed robbers were on the prowl in the city.







Customers, who approached their banks at 11am, met the gates locked and those who were already in the premises were politely told to leave.



It was gathered that the information first reached one of the banks from where it was related to other banks.



The police was also promptly alerted, which in turn, deployed its men in the city to counter any attack.



Security operatives comprising soldiers and policemen patrolled the Oyemekun, Oba Adesida and Arakale roads in the city, where the banks are located, while Armoured Personnel Carriers were also stationed at some strategic locations.



State Police Public Relations Officer, Mr Wole Ogodo, confirmed the development, saying the police had fully taken control of the situation.



He said the state police command was proactive and had quickly sent a formidable patrol to effectively man the likely areas of attack.



Ogodo added that the police command would not relent in its fight against crimes in the state.
